The following, is a transcription of The Verve's 'I See The Door' by Kris
Robertson.  This song was not on any of their albums, but is very popular
among fans, who will recognise it as a b-side to 'On Your Own.'

One point to note is that while playing all these chords (except D) you
have to hold down the first and second strings on the third fret.
